Route 4 via Jemez Springs covers 54.4km and 1,162m of climbing, reaching 2,774m at the summit. The average gradient of 2.1% disguises ramps of 8.1% — the kind of gradient that turns plans into prayers. This is a climb of endurance — the kind of effort measured in hours, where pacing matters more than power. The summit at 2,774m sits above the treeline, where the air thins and the views extend to distant peaks. Located in New Mexico, United-states.
